- Frontend v4 accessible sur réseau local (192.168.1.40) - Ports ouverts: 3002 (frontend), 5001 (backend), 5004 (dashboard) - Ollama GPU fonctionnel - Self-healing interactif - Dashboard confiance Co-Authored-By: Claude Opus 4.5 <noreply@anthropic.com>
3.0 KiB
3.0 KiB
✅ Application Démarrée - Test Maintenant !
🎯 L'application est prête
Les services sont démarrés :
- ✅ Backend : http://localhost:5001
- ✅ Frontend : http://localhost:3000
🧪 Instructions de test
1. Ouvrir l'application
Ouvre ton navigateur et va sur :
http://localhost:3000
2. Ouvrir la console du navigateur
Appuie sur F12 (ou Cmd+Option+I sur Mac) pour ouvrir les DevTools, puis va dans l'onglet Console.
3. Test du clic simple
- Dans la palette à gauche, clique sur "Cliquer"
- Regarde la console, tu devrais voir :
Palette: Node clicked: click App: Adding node of type: click App: New node created: {id: "node-...", type: "click", ...} App: Updated nodes: [...] - Le node devrait apparaître sur le canvas !
4. Test du drag-and-drop
- Dans la palette, clique et maintiens sur "Saisir du texte"
- Glisse vers le canvas (zone centrale)
- Relâche où tu veux placer le node
- Regarde la console, tu devrais voir :
Canvas: Drop event triggered Canvas: Node type from drag: type Canvas: Calling onNodeAdd with type: type App: Adding node of type: type App: New node created: {id: "node-...", type: "type", ...} App: Updated nodes: [...] - Le node devrait apparaître où tu l'as relâché !
📊 Ce que tu devrais voir
Dans le navigateur :
- Une interface avec 3 zones :
- Gauche : Palette avec les nodes (Cliquer, Saisir du texte, etc.)
- Centre : Canvas (zone de travail)
- Droite : Panneau de propriétés
Dans la console :
- Des logs qui montrent le flux d'exécution
- Aucune erreur rouge
Sur le canvas :
- Les nodes que tu ajoutes apparaissent
- Tu peux les déplacer
- Tu peux les connecter
❌ Si ça ne fonctionne pas
Le clic ne fonctionne pas
Symptôme : Rien ne se passe quand tu cliques sur un node dans la palette
Vérifier :
- Y a-t-il des logs dans la console ?
- Y a-t-il des erreurs rouges ?
- Partage les logs avec moi
Le drag-and-drop ne fonctionne pas
Symptôme : Le node ne se dépose pas sur le canvas
Vérifier :
- Le curseur change-t-il en "grab" (main) quand tu survoles un node ?
- Y a-t-il des logs "Canvas: Drop event triggered" ?
- Y a-t-il des erreurs dans la console ?
- Partage les logs avec moi
Le warning React Flow persiste
Symptôme : Tu vois encore le warning sur nodeTypes/edgeTypes
C'est normal : Le warning devrait avoir disparu avec nos corrections. Si tu le vois encore, rafraîchis la page (Ctrl+R).
📝 Partage tes résultats
Une fois que tu as testé, dis-moi :
- ✅ ou ❌ Le clic fonctionne ?
- ✅ ou ❌ Le drag-and-drop fonctionne ?
- ✅ ou ❌ Le warning React Flow a disparu ?
- Copie-colle les logs de la console (s'il y en a)
🎉 Si tout fonctionne
Félicitations ! Le drag-and-drop est opérationnel. On pourra ensuite :
- Retirer les console.log de débogage
- Améliorer l'UX
- Ajouter plus de fonctionnalités
Bon test ! 🚀